EDA365电子工程师网

标题: 【转帖】分享一个PADS“选项”界面显示不全的解决办法 [打印本页]

作者: 无涯    时间: 2016-7-14 17:51
标题: 【转帖】分享一个PADS“选项”界面显示不全的解决办法
PADS 9.5、PADS VX 在windows 8、windows 8.1及windows 10系统上运行会出现“选项”界面显示不全的问题,以前都是通过修改资源文件的方法解决,现在有一个比较方便的方法,是通过修改注册表的方法解决。! \. e* p' V. {1 g' Y

  r2 O( p: {0 F, g. _9 K% v 方法如下:4 u3 w  b4 Y- z: G
首先打开注册表。按 WIN+R 键, 然后输入 regedit ,回车,打开注册表,然后进行以下操作:) G& j5 A. G8 w  |, S
5 m5 b4 S6 S7 h4 Q( V7 j1 B8 R+ f
1. 路径:  9 X4 z, l" C* I$ i/ }! H
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Fonts]
" [  R2 M8 K. n; S6 ?, e' d( t
( z3 P9 ?" z$ Q; m: E- @( A将原来的:
2 `6 I& V4 o0 l# F "Microsoft YaHei (TrueType) & Microsoft YaHei UI (TrueType)"  
. ]. H9 ^. T# B; {- n# y ="msyh.ttc"
- _% \$ y6 y  v- ]2 P "Microsoft YaHei Bold & Microsoft YaHei UI Bold (TrueType)"  
+ Q3 l: t% e/ \- j- R+ | ="msyhbd.ttc"   r- K2 c! p& g3 e. [$ x' z
"Microsoft YaHei Light & Microsoft YaHei UI Light (TrueType)"  
- E+ f" F! e9 F4 X4 z ="msyhl.ttc" % t3 E5 Y& c% s3 l9 {4 Q' p7 f# R
修改为:
' A0 h7 u7 `; P" Y" G "Microsoft YaHei & Microsoft YaHei UI (TrueType)"  
. B; [7 f/ t0 o3 Z- @, ^. F8 D0 E = "simsun.ttc"
7 u  T! @/ d4 p1 L+ C5 X3 Q9 G/ \ "Microsoft YaHei Bold & Microsoft YaHei UI Bold (TrueType)"    z! u. x& ?7 K0 w. ^! V. `, e: _3 P! B
= "simsun.ttc"
& M& P5 h# ?4 k$ E# G" N% f6 ] "Microsoft YaHei Light & Microsoft YaHei UI Light (TrueType)"  
/ M0 c! K- |  D- r = "simsun.ttc"
( [8 ?1 ?" X# i$ F5 D. A& H2 C 2.  
$ A: _% h4 H8 C0 ?) H& o 路径:  
+ U, [( W: a% C( P+ i1 Z! x [H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ontSubstitutes] 3 G* B# ]# x' h/ h0 `5 u
新增字串:
3 N8 I/ P2 z+ Y% E) ~ "Microsoft YaHei"  
" p$ @' Q. `( b& A = "SimSun" 7 b" d2 y4 |: t5 p7 O
"Microsoft YaHei UI"  & A7 F" k( ]$ e! {8 z6 C$ E
= "SimSun"
2 {2 ?. d5 U2 s4 b" r 3. 重启
8 N) d0 w; j  G& P& V 事实证明, 通过修改默认字体的方法是可以解决问题的。因为 Win10 的默认字体与宋体的行高存在差异才会导致此类问题。
  B9 m9 q& `3 _/ l4 ]注意,修改字体不仅仅是影响Pads,整个系统都受影响,不喜欢这些变动的话,还是用老办法吧。
; b9 Z: u. J1 o$ V4 o
) E4 s) O: v8 Y6 E: Y- ~# z
作者: dali618    时间: 2016-7-14 19:11
好的,mark
作者: leipei    时间: 2016-7-15 08:27
好的,mark
作者: jieking    时间: 2016-7-15 16:35
楼主 试过了?
作者: 无涯    时间: 2016-7-15 20:18
jieking 发表于 2016-7-15 16:35
+ x; J' Z7 ?% ^, p楼主 试过了?
1 t! P; b* H1 o/ A7 g
是的,试过了,试过后,转帖时加了一句,“注意,修改字体不仅仅是影响Pads,整个系统都受影响,不喜欢这些变动的话,还是用老办法吧。”
5 C/ L9 R8 e. j5 L5 D' U这也解决了我的一个疑惑,这么明显的Bug,为何N年都没改过来?原来在人家的系统上,根本就没这问题
, E/ I6 x" J% f. p/ f) A5 i
作者: topdenzengzhi    时间: 2016-7-16 08:41
LZ厉害,谢谢分享
作者: 梦醉人生    时间: 2016-7-29 12:00
厉害
作者: 老玉米    时间: 2016-10-23 14:45
不知道第二步的新增字符串怎么操作。。。
作者: 无涯    时间: 2016-10-23 17:24
老玉米 发表于 2016-10-23 14:45+ l0 n. q& E: Z  p  e
不知道第二步的新增字符串怎么操作。。。
9 s5 j9 x; U' N- ~

8 y& M3 m( g9 ?7 I. z2 C右边空白处点右键,“new”->"String Value"
+ E3 @& i. X. O% t# V, U; ?! V8 |% t! u2 q! Z4 f5 z& I) b9 N9 k. X

作者: owencai    时间: 2016-10-30 00:04
谢谢分享
作者: xueling2009    时间: 2016-11-18 10:23
MARK,以后如果遇到可以看看。
作者: jswjl    时间: 2017-3-12 19:21
感谢分享。
作者: jswjl    时间: 2017-3-12 19:46
老办法是什么办法?我不想系统受影响,感谢,盼复!
作者: 无涯    时间: 2017-3-13 19:13
jswjl 发表于 2017-3-12 19:460 s6 a2 X9 {4 U7 `6 L+ B9 ~
老办法是什么办法?我不想系统受影响,感谢,盼复!

; u, x! w2 i0 |& N% A有人已经把相关文件改好,只需在论坛里找一找,替换即可。  Z4 u5 V4 K  r- L
如果找不到,可以自己动手,用工具(比如Visual Studio)加装资源文件,修改然后保存即可。
7 I# K( w# u2 u! u% S( X  J* S4 N: `8 }: c





欢迎光临 EDA365电子工程师网 (https://bbs.elecnest.cn/) Powered by Discuz! X3.2